如何实现“java awt linux 宋体”
操作流程
flowchart TD
A(准备工作) --> B(设置字体)
B --> C(编写代码)
C --> D(运行程序)
具体步骤
1. 准备工作
在Linux系统中,需要确认系统中已经安装了宋体字体,并且字体文件路径正确。
2. 设置字体
// 设置字体
Font font = new Font("宋体", Font.PLAIN, 12);
这行代码的意思是设置字体为宋体,大小为12号,普通样式。
3. 编写代码
在编写AWT程序时,可以使用以下代码实现字体效果:
import java.awt.Font;
import java.awt.Graphics;
import java.awt.Frame;
public class FontDemo extends Frame {
public void paint(Graphics g) {
// 设置字体
Font font = new Font("宋体", Font.PLAIN, 12);
g.setFont(font);
// 绘制文字
g.drawString("这是宋体字体", 100, 100);
}
public static void main(String[] args) {
FontDemo fd = new FontDemo();
fd.setSize(300, 200);
fd.setVisible(true);
}
}
4. 运行程序
编译并运行上述代码,即可在Linux系统中看到使用宋体字体的效果。
pie
title 字体使用情况
"宋体" : 100
通过以上步骤,你可以成功在Java AWT程序中实现使用宋体字体的效果。希望这篇文章对你有所帮助,祝你学习顺利!